This weekend is the ARRL DX Contest Phone (SSB). The contest lasts 48 hours. It starts 0000 UTC Saturday (Friday Evening) and ends 2400 UTC Sunday, Sunday night. The Objective is for amateurs work as many amateur stations in as many DXCC countries of the world as possible on 160, 80, 40, 20, 15, and 10 meter bands. The exchange of information is signal report and state (MI or Michigan). The ARRL Contest Branch is again offering pins for the 2008 International DX Contest. The sharp four-color design will prominently display the year 2008. To earn the International DX Contest pin, all you need to do is complete 100. There are not separate pins for each mode. You may contact the same station on different bands. The cost is $7 (US) in the US, its possessions and Canada, and $10 for others (postage included). Your pins will be shipped once all logs for the contest have been processed and verified by the log checking team for publication in QST. To purchase your pin send a copy of the first page of your Cabrillo log file along with your payment to: DX Contest Pins, ARRL, 225 Main St, Newington CT 06111. Pins are only guaranteed for orders received by April 4, 2008. Please allow 6-8 weeks for delivery after the order deadline.
